TICKET-4182: Pondrel's websocket client keeps reconnecting in staging because the heartbeat interval was copied from the prod env without the matching timeout. Future maintainers: the reconnect loop is a symptom, not the bug. Fix is to align both values in .env.staging. After correcting the interval, the socket auth line must follow immediately, as shown below.

secret setting of yajog-taguf: ARCHIVE_KEY3=051

## Nightly Reindex Capacity Note

The Quernstone search cluster rebuilds its full index every night between 02:00 and 05:00. Plugin authors: your enrichment hooks run inside this window and count against the shared worker pool. Budget accordingly — a hook averaging over 40ms per document will push the run past the window and get auto-disabled. Heavy transforms should precompute during the day and read from cache at index time. Memory per worker is fixed. Plan against the constants below.

tuning table, yajog-yahof:
BUDGETS = {
    "lamvan": 303,
    "wenox": 460,
    "fenvan": 525,
}

Compaction limits for the Pipewren queue, for this week's sync. Segments compact when the dirty ratio crosses threshold or age expires. Exceeding the open-segment quota blocks producers, so these numbers matter. We raised retention after the Tuesday backlog. Current production values are as follows.

tuning table, kajog-kawef:
PRIORITIES = {
    "kelox": 870,
    "kasix": 89,
    "eliax": 988,
}

Q: Why does the Lattimer tax-rate lookup cache sometimes serve stale rates after a jurisdiction update?

A: The cache uses a 24-hour TTL keyed on jurisdiction code, and invalidation messages from the upstream Ratebook service are best-effort. If a message is dropped, stale entries persist until TTL expiry. Maintainers can force a flush via the admin job, but note this triggers a thundering-herd reload, so do it off-peak. The flush procedure, capacity considerations, and known edge cases are documented on the internal page linked below.

wiki page, tagep-baweg: https://jira.lumicsys.internal/display/display/browse/display